
Paperback
Published 12 Jul 2010
Save $3.83
- RRP $45.05
- $41.22
5 results
$3.83off
Paperback
Published 12 Jul 2010
Save $3.83
Hardback
Published 12 Jul 2010
$4.34off
Paperback
Published 30 Oct 2013
Save $4.34
Paperback
Published 18 Aug 2023
Paperback
Published 15 Nov 2010